Affiliate Article Marketing Basics



If you’re looking to make money as an affiliate marketer, you’ve probably heard about, and thought about article marketing. After all, especially if you’re new to affiliate marketing, you probably don’t have a lot of money to spend on ad campaigns and the like. Even if you have the money, surely the idea of getting long-term income from writing articles has appealed to you.

Article marketing offers many benefits for affiliates, including the way it can direct well-qualified candidates to your offer, and the fact that you can do it without spending any money.

There are a few things you should keep in mind when designing your marketing campaign:

For the most long-term benefit, you should drive traffic to a lead capture page, or an opt-in page where you collect their name and e-mail address before anything else. Eventually, your list can become your greatest asset as it gives you a ready-made, and highly-responsive audience for your offers. Your articles must be of sufficient quality to keep the reader’s attention, while stimulating them to want to click on the link at the end to get more information. You want a high percentage of the traffic that comes to your site to click through. Your articles need to focus on the right keywords. It does no good to have the best ranked article on a keyword no one cares about or that doesn’t lead to any sales. The old brute force, write a hundred articles and you’ll make money days of article marketing are gone. You need to have a system in place that gets massive amounts of traffic to your articles if you’re going to make money.

If you’re going to succeed as an affiliate marketer, you definitely should consider article marketing as a way to drive targeted traffic. You can still make good money through affiliate article marketing if you work hard and have a system that’s in tune with the way the business works today.

According to the “Restaurant Magazine” chose a list of 50 places worth visiting. These included restaurants, bars and eating joints of various kinds from the world over. The criteria were food, ambiance and service among other things. Here is the list of their ten favorite ones:

1. El Bulli – Spain: This is an exclusive restaurant with only a seating of 50 people. It only opens for dinner between April to December and has received the honor of being world’s best restaurant many times.

2. The Fat Duck – UK: They are open between Tuesday and Sunday for lunch (12-2) and dinner (7-9:30). You can choose between the tasting menu and the a la carte menu here.

3. Pierre Gagnaire – France: This restaurant is one of its kind and very unique. It is named after the owner and chef of the place. It is known for its innovative and exotic dishes.

4. The French Laundry – USA: It is open for dinner seven days a week but for lunch only on the weekends. They have two menus that are changed daily.

5. Tetsuya’s – Australia: It is open from Tuesdays to Sundays for dinner from 6pm and only on Saturdays for lunch from 12 pm. It is famous for amazing Japanese cuisine.

6. Bras – France: It is known around the world for Gargouillou de Jeunes L?gumes which is a vegetable dish and considered the best in the world.

7. Mugaritz – Spain: Known for unique and remarkable duck recopies.

8. Le Louis XV – Monaco: This has a very elaborate and stunning ambiance and that is what gives it a royal touch. The food is tasty yet simple.

9. Per Se – USA: Based on the design of the French Laundry and known for serving some great food.

10. Arzak – Spain: It is a unique restaurant known for its experimental approach towards food.
